Describe the bug / error
Any SPFX Webpart deployed to teams , having graph connections is throwing this error in my tenant
The provided grant has expired due to it being revoked, a fresh auth token is needed. The user might have changed or reset their password. The grant was issued on '{authTime}' and the TokensValidFrom date (before which tokens are not valid) for this user is '{validDate}'. Additional Details Expected part of the token lifecycle - either an admin or a user revoked the tokens for this user, causing subsequent token refreshes to fail and require re-authentication. Have the user sign-in again.

@harshdamaniahd - Deleting the service principal will not help you. What you are seeing is unfortunately expected behavior right now. When you are using the mobile client are authentication is based on having previously logged into SharePoint. This is being fixed and the fix is currently being rolled out to production. Once it rolls to production your issue will be fixed in the mobile client.
